Why do we experience joint pain?
Joint and back pain frequently results from injury to or overuse of the tendons and ligaments that support a particular joint. Because ligaments naturally lack good blood supply, healing time tends to be slow compared to other tissues in the body. If the ligaments heal back to their normal length and strength, the joint will regain its stability. Often, however, after enduring injury, ligaments become stretched and are unable to resume the support to the join they once held. This instability can cause inflammation and pain.
How does prolotherapy work?
Prolotherapy involves administering precise injections of dextrose, glycerine, and procaine into the ligaments and tendons surrounding a joint. Each treatment promotes the body’s own natural healing ability. Growth factors encourage more and more tissue to regenerate in the needed areas. As the joint becomes stronger and more stabilized, pain lessens, and in most cases disappears entirely.
